An aluminum 45-degree cutting machine, also known as an aluminum miter cutting saw, comes in many models to suit different work requirements. This includes the difference between the sizes of the cutting machines. Smaller bench-top machines are popular because of their portability and how easy they are to use. All the user has to do is place the aluminum on the machine and clamp it down before cutting. They work well for light jobs. In contrast, bigger setups, like the vertical aluminum cutting machine, provide better stability and precision for more intensive work. Power and capacity also differ from one type of aluminum cutting machine to another. Generally, the higher the horsepower (HP), the more powerful the machine is, allowing it to cut through thicker profiles of aluminum. Stand cutting machines are popular because they are standalone and easy to operate.
Cutting Length:
This refers to the maximum length of the aluminum piece that the machine can cut. Generally, it ranges from 2 to 4 meters.
Cutting Thickness:
The machine is capable of processing aluminum's thickness. It normally falls between 0.5 and 3 centimeters.
Cutting Angle:
Some machines have the ability to cut angles other than 45 degrees. The cutting accuracy and angle range of an aluminum cutting machine is its exactness in achieving the desired angles. Machines that offer a broader range of settings and higher precision are preferable for complicated projects.
Power and Speed:
The motor's power output is measured in kilowatts (kW) or horsepower (HP), which determines the machine's cutting speed. The cutting speed is a critical aspect, and the specifications of the machine usually indicate it in meters per minute (RPM).
Blade Diameter and Material:
The cutting blade's diameter affects the range of thicknesses that the machine can handle. Furthermore, different blade materials offer distinct cutting capabilities and efficiencies.
Machine Dimensions and Weight:
These specifications are essential for understanding the machine's size and weight, which are critical for installation and transportation requirements.
Whether it is a manual aluminum cutting machine or an automatic one, maintenance is always critical. Regular maintenance ensures the machine is clean, while preventing breakdowns and prolonging its lifespan. As a result, users need to familiarize themselves with the optimal maintenance practices. They also need to understand the essential parts of the machine that require frequent maintenance.
Cleaning:
Users should regularly remove aluminum residues from cuts and other debris. This prevents dust and chips from accumulating on the machine. After cleaning, they should wipe the entire machine with a soft cloth.
Lubrication:
Frequent lubrication is important to ensure moving parts operate smoothly and reduce friction. Normally, this involves applying lubrication oil to chains, bearings, guide rails, and other moving components.
Blade Maintenance:
Users should inspect the cutting blades regularly to check for damages, such as deformation or dullness. They should also clean them to prevent the build-up of residue on the blades.
Machine Inspection:
Users should carry out regular inspections checking fasteners to see if they are loose. Also, they should inspect the electrical connections and the components to check for signs of damage or wear. Between insurrections, users should pay attention to unusual noises from the cutting machines. There could be a stumbling block, such as a friction producing noise. In case of any unusual sound, users should stop the machine immediately and check the issue closely.
Construction industry:
The construction industry extensively uses the 45-degree cutting machine to create window frames, door frames, and structural components. The aluminum frame cutting machine helps builders to make precise cuts for roof trusses, beams, and framing elements.
Architectural projects and carpentry:
Architects and carpenters rely on the 45-degree aluminum cutter to craft intricate moldings, trims, and decorative elements. The machine allows for seamless joints and aesthetically pleasing fixtures.
Automotive industry:
In the automotive sector, the 45-degree cutting machine is used for cutting aluminum components, such as chassis parts, window frames, and structural elements. Its accuracy ensures proper fitment and assembly of vehicles.
Furniture manufacturing:
Furniture makers utilize the 45-degree cutter to create furniture pieces like tables, cabinets, and doors with miter joints. The machine enables them to achieve stylish joints that enhance the overall look of the furniture.
HVAC systems:
In HVAC (Heating, Ventilation, and Air Conditioning) systems installation, the 45-degree cutting machine is used to cut aluminum ducts and conduits. Accurate cuts are essential for proper fitting and aligning of HVAC components.
Signage and display industry:
The signage and display industry uses the machine to create aluminum frames, stands, and signboards. The accuracy and precision of the machine ensure perfect angles and cuts for signage development and assembly.
Marine industry:
Marine industry fabricators use the 45-degree cutting machine to cut aluminum for boats, yachts, and marine structures. The tool helps make precise cuts for constructing hulls, decks, and marine equipment.
Sports equipment manufacturing:
Manufacturers of sports equipment, such as bicycles, wheelchair frames, and sporting goods, use the 45-degree cutting machine to achieve precise cuts for assembling lightweight and durable sports gear.
Custom fabrication shops:
Custom fabrication shops employ the 45-degree cutter to create one-of-a-kind aluminum products and prototypes. Whether for art installations or functional custom pieces, the machine ensures accurate cuts for mate tailored creations.
There are many options when it comes to choosing the perfect aluminum 45-degree cutting machine. When selecting a machine, it is imperative to keep in mind the maximum material thickness and cutting capacity. When determining this factor, consider what materials the machine will be working with. If there is no possible way to reduce the machine's power requirements, look for ones with efficient power usage.
To find the most suitable machine, test its ease of use. A complex machine can provide accurate cuts but can become burdensome over time. Therefore, checking for its intuitive controls and familiar operation is important. Its safety features are also a crucial component to inquire about. A well-balanced, ergonomic, and easy-to-operate machine will help protect the user from any accidents.
When choosing the perfect aluminum cutting machine, look for one with efficient dust collection. This will help maintain a clean workspace and reduce any fire hazards that may come from aluminum particles. The machine's compatibility with different types of blades is also important and should be inquired about. If the blade needs to be replaced frequently, it can increase operating costs and downtime.
Whether it is a manual, semi-automatic, or fully automatic machine is also a crucial inquiry. Manual machines provide more control over the cutting process, while fully automatic machines offer faster production speeds. Semi-automatic machines are a combination of both. Q1: Can someone cut various materials with an aluminum 45-degree cutting machine?
A1: The capability of the 45-degree aluminum cutting machine depends mainly on its blades. Some blades are ideal for cutting aluminum and steel, while others are suited for wood. Therefore, regarding whether one can cut different materials using an aluminum 45-degree cutting machine, the answer is yes, but only in cases where the machine uses blades designed to cut those materials.
Q2: Does the 45-degree aluminum cutting machine requires special maintenance?
A2: Generally, aluminum cutting machines require minimal maintenance. That said, operators should frequently clean the machine to remove any residue or dust. Also, they should lubricate any moving parts to reduce any friction and subsequently prolong the machine's lifespan. Additionally, it's essential to maintain the blade, ensuring it's sharpened and well-maintained.
Q3: Can someone replace the blade on an aluminum 45-degree cutting machine?
A3: Yes. Users can replace the existing blade with another one, provided the machine ideally fits the blade.
Q4: Does an aluminum 45-degree cutting machine have a maximum cutting depth?
A4: Yes, every aluminum 45-degree cutting machine has a maximum cutting depth, usually specified by the manufacturer. Generally, this cutting depth varies from one machine to another based on various factors, including size, power, and specifications.
